Summary
This study tests if giving very premature babies (born before 30 weeks) slightly less fluid (135 mL per kg per day) compared to a standard amount (165 mL per kg per day) can prevent bronchopulmonary dysplasia (BPD), a chronic lung disease. About 750 babies will be enrolled across multiple hospitals. The goal is to see if this simple change in care reduces BPD or death by 36 weeks corrected age.
